God desires a relationship with you.
Genesus 2:7-9
How awesome is it to think that the God that created all desired a relationship with you.
He would not have made man if this was not the case
You were created for His good pleasure
God Provides
God Provides
1st Let’s look at God’s provision for Adam and Eve
Genesis 2:7-8
God makes man, naturally He provides for them.
He is like a parent providing for His children.
I brought them into this world, you can guarantee I will make sure they are provided for.
Who am I that God is mindful of me?
Not only is He mindful of us but He loves us.
He didn't just set it and forget it.
He even provided Jesus as the ultimate sacrifice before time began
God provided everything we need in life through creation and the cross

God Relates
As the creator of man, God knew that we would long for companionship.
Anyone want the biblical principle for dating?
Genesis 2:18-
As the creator of man, God knew that we would long for companionship, as such, he knows us deeply, knowing exactly what we need in a spouse.
An interesting turn of events takes place
God say its not good for man to be alone
He then brings the animals before Adam so that he could name them
Adam did not find an help meet out of the animals
God brings a help meet to Adam.
The order here is crucial.
When Adam was searching for a companion he didn’t find one.
GOD BROUGHT ONE TO HIM.
Don’t go looking on your own.
You do not need to go searching for a BF/GF
